Abstract

An invention directed to a mosquito repelling device is disclosed. The disclosed mosquito repelling apparatus includes: an input unit for inputting an operation signal; a control unit for receiving an operation signal of the input unit; and an ultrasonic generator for generating ultrasonic waves of a preset band to prevent access to the mosquito according to a control signal of the control unit .

MOSQUITO EXTRACTION DEVICE

More particularly, the present invention relates to a mosquito repelling device having a compact structure, which is easy to carry and which can eject ultrasound selectively in unidirectional and bidirectional directions, thereby improving mosquito repelling efficiency .

A mosquito is a pest that takes in the blood of a person or an animal and feeds the nutrient. It can be said that it is a very dangerous insect such as a harmful germ can be removed from an animal.

Accordingly, in order to combat mosquitoes, people are showing a variety of products such as mosquito nets as well as passive methods such as mosquito nets, but there are side effects such as not being able to see much effect and affecting the human body.

In recent years, techniques for preventing access to a mosquito while harmless to the human body using electromagnetic waves have been developed and commercialized and used.

In general, mosquitoes are known to feed on the spawning period for female mosquitoes for nutritional purposes.

For mosquitoes that keep semen for a lifetime in one mating, they have the characteristic of avoiding the male's womb because mating is no longer necessary.

Thus, a mosquito repellent apparatus using a sound of a male mosquito has been disclosed through a variety of studies, in which a female mosquito dislikes a wing sound of a male wolf, a metallic bouncing sound, and the like.

1 to 6, a mosquito repelling apparatus 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ention includes an input unit 120, a controller 130, and an ultrasonic generator 140.

First, the input unit 120, the control unit 130, and the ultrasonic wave generator 140 are provided in the case 110. The case 110 includes front and rear cases 112 and 114 and is coupled by a fastening member and a space is formed therein.

The input unit 120 is a slide switch for inputting an operation signal and being slidably operated.

Although the input unit 120 is shown as a slide switch in the present embodiment, the present invention is not limited thereto, and various switches capable of inputting operation signals such as a button switch and a tumbler switch are possible.

The control unit 130 receives an operation signal of the input unit 120. The control unit 130 includes a circuit board provided inside the case 110. The controller 130 is coupled to the case 110 by fastening members when the case 110 is assembled. 2, the front case 112 is provided with a boss 113 protruding rearward, and a control unit 130 is provided between the boss 113 and the rear case 114, It is concluded together by.

The ultrasonic wave generator 140 includes an ultrasonic oscillator 142 for generating ultrasonic waves according to a control signal of the controller 130 and a speaker 145 for diverting ultrasonic waves generated from the ultrasonic oscillator 142 to the outside. The ultrasonic oscillation unit 142 generates ultrasonic waves in a medium. The ultrasonic oscillation unit 142 generates high frequency electric oscillations, converts the oscillations into mechanical oscillations by using a magnetostrictive resonator or a piezoelectric resonator, To be mechanically amplified or transmitted.

The ultrasonic wave generator 140 repeatedly generates ultrasonic waves of a specific frequency band (12,000 Hz to 17,000 Hz). Such an ultrasonic wave is the sound of a male mosquito's wing, and it prevents the mosquitoes from approaching by running away the cancerous mosquito that sucks blood.

Referring to FIG. 2 or FIG. 4, a power supply unit 150 for supplying power to the inside of the case 110 is provided. The power supply unit 150 includes a pocket retainer 152 electrically connected to the controller 130 and a battery 154 coupled to the pocket retainer 152. The pair of pocket retainers 152 are provided on both sides of the front side of the control unit 130 and the batteries 154 are provided in the pocket retainers 152 to extend the power source life and improve the output. The mosquito repelling device 100 according to the example can have a compact structure.

The speaker 145 is disposed in front of and behind the case 110 with respect to the control unit 130 and output holes 112b and 114b are formed in the case 110 so as to correspond to the speaker 145. This can output the ultrasonic waves generated from the ultrasonic oscillation unit 142 through the speaker 145 in one direction or in both directions.

At this time, mounting grooves 112a and 114a are formed in the front case 112 and the rear case 114, respectively, to which the respective speakers 145 can be mounted.

The case 110 is provided with a display unit 160 indicating the operating state of the ultrasonic wave generator 140. The display unit 160 is composed of a light emitting diode and displays an operating state according to lighting.

Meanwhile, the control unit 130 includes a notification unit 170 for detecting an environment in which a mosquito appears. That is, the notification unit 170 can detect the environment of the mosquito and inform the user of the environment. The notification unit 170 includes a sensing unit 172 for sensing the atmospheric temperature and the atmospheric humidity and a buzzer 174 selectively activated by the sensing value of the sensing unit 172.

The sensing unit 172 includes a temperature sensor 172a for sensing the temperature of the atmosphere and a humidity sensor 172b for sensing the humidity of the atmosphere. That is, the mosquito exhibits the most active activity in a temperature of 15 ° C or higher and a humidity of 70% or higher. When the mosquito detects such environment, it can inform the user through the buzzer 174.
